Ex9L-N residual current circuit breakers are suitable mainly for domestic applications. They are based on electromagnetic principle. It brings the advantage of Voltage independent function. Adequate voltage is only necessary when testing the RCCB with the T test button. Magnetic RCCBs should be tested regularly with a period of one month. 6 kA variant of the Ex9L-N residual current circuit breaker is intended mainly for low demanding application like basic protection in household installations.
PAREMETER | VALUE |
---|---|
Mounting method | DIN rail |
Short-circuit breaking capacity (Icw) | 6 |
Frequency | 50 Hz |
Built-in depth | 79 |
Short-time delayed tripping | NO |
Additional equipment possible | NO |
Degree of protection (IP) | IP20 |
Rated fault current | 0.03 |
Surge current capacity | 3 |
Nominal rated voltage | 400 |
Construction size (in accordance with DIN 43880) | 4 |
Width in number of modular spacings | 4 |
Number of poles (total) | 4 |
Nominal rated current | 25 |
Leakage current type | AC |
Selective protection | NO |
